Position Summary

We are looking for a talented and motivated Senior Video Editor to join our in-house creative team. This role is primarily focused on video editing and post-production — crafting polished, high-quality content for marketing campaigns, social media, digital platforms, and brand storytelling across Celebrity Cruises channels.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

  • Edit video content across a variety of formats including brand campaigns, social media, digital ads, and internal marketing materials.
  • Utilize AI generation tools (such as Higgsfield, Seedance, Kling, or similar platforms) to concept, generate, and refine visual content as part of the editing and production workflow.
  • Use After Effects for motion graphics, visual enhancements, and creative finishing.
  • Collaborate closely with the Creative Director and marketing team to ensure all content aligns with brand guidelines and campaign objectives.
  • Deliver platform-specific versions of video assets optimized for web, social, broadcast, and digital signage.
  • Review and refine edits based on internal feedback, maintaining a constructive and open approach to creative direction.
  • Stay current on trends in video production, editing techniques, and AI-generated content.
  • Organize and manage video assets within the team's digital asset library.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
